Important Factors to Consider Before BuyingMeasure Twice, Buy Once
It sounds basic, however improper measurement is the top factor for fridge returns. Beyond the height, width, and depth of the fridge cavity, remember to:
Check clearance: Ensure doors can swing open totally without striking walls, islands, or cabinets.Account for airflow: Most [fridges](https://ionarv.com/author/buy-a-fridge-online6694/) need a little space on the sides and leading to permit heat to dissipate.Check delivery path: Can the appliance fit through your front door and around tight corridor corners?Capacity and Internal Layout
Consider your grocery shopping routines. If you purchase wholesale, prioritize a design with deep drawers and adjustable shelving. If you regularly host supper parties, look for models with specialized functions like "flex-zones," which allow you to transform a portion of the freezer into fridge area for extra cold storage.
Energy Efficiency
Refrigerators are one of the couple of home appliances that never get a break. An Energy Star-certified design may cost a little bit more in advance, but the long-lasting cost savings on your utility expenses are typically significant. Look for the yellow EnergyGuide label to compare approximated yearly operating expenses.
Smart Features: Necessity or Gimmick?
Modern refrigerators now feature touchscreens, internal cameras, and Wi-Fi connectivity. While these functions can assist you track expiration dates or handle grocery lists, they also increase the cost and the capacity for technical malfunctions. Decide if you truly require "linked" functions or if you choose a simpler, more long lasting maker.
4. Maintenance Best Practices
When your new fridge is set up, following an upkeep routine will extend its lifespan by years.
Vacuum the Condenser Coils: Dust buildup on the coils forces the motor to work more difficult. Do this at least every six months.Check Door Gaskets: Ensure the rubber seals are tight. If they lose their suction, cold air leaves, making the compressor run continuously.Replace Water Filters: If your fridge has an ice maker or water dispenser, alter the filter every 6 months to preserve water quality and avoid scale accumulation.5. Q: Should I buy a fridge with an ice maker inside or on the door?A: External dispensers (on the door) are practical, but they are also a typical point of mechanical failure and use up valuable door space. Internal ice makers are normally more reputable and offer more storage space.

Q: Does stainless steel really reveal finger prints?A: Traditional stainless steel does hold finger prints easily. Nevertheless, lots of makers now offer "fingerprint-resistant" stainless finishes that are much easier to keep clean, particularly in families with children.

Q: What is the ideal temperature for a fridge?A: To keep food safe and prevent wasting, the refrigerator compartment need to remain between 35 ° F and 38 ° F (1.7 ° C to 3.3 ° C ), and the freezer needs to be kept at 0 ° F (-18 ° C).
